Just come back from OTx - so thought I'd start having another look at Fusion in the Browser and its potential for cloud use in schools with current adopted curriculum.
The main projects that are being utilised currently are the Desk top Lamp project - the F1 in schools Helmet and the F1 in schools (car design project.
I thought i would start with the Desk lamp project - One thing I notice straight away is that in the curriculum the main profile of the design is sketched from an image imported into the canvas (this is also the same in the F1 helmet design) - Does the current version have the ability to import an image and calibrate it to a size? As I couldn't locate it.
Another thing I noticed that the move command only allows the solid body to be moved along the axis, there is no rotational manipulator - I saw the 'choose axis' dialogue in the pop up menu but once you select an axis there is no rotation available - again is this something i am missing, or is it something that is on its way.
The rest of the sketching of the design seemed fine and was easy to replicate

"...Does the current version have the ability to import an image and calibrate it to a size?"
No we don;t have the ability to support images of any kind, however, this is on our roadmap
"...there is no rotational manipulator"
We have some work to do to support this, so it has been removed for now. It might not make the first version, but is a priority. I will log an issue for the "popup menu"
